BIOLOGICAL TREATMENT OF HYDROCARBON COMPOUNDS IN OIL REFINERY WASTE WATER

Abstract

ABSTRCTThree types of microorganisms are used in this study to show the differencebetween their ability in consumption of the hydrocarbon residual in the industrialwaste water of the Al-Doura refinery. These types are: Protozoa (taken fromAl-Doura refinery) and two local isolates: P. aeruginosa and P. fluorescens. Thesehave been already tested boichemically, physiologically and according to API 20Esystem method. Box-Wilson method is used to find the mathematical relationsbetween the variables (temperature, pH and inoculate amount) with biomassamount during the hydrocarbon residual consumption. The obtained experimentalresults are fitted to a polynomial function of second order. The experiments arecarried out using batch culture for both the three isolates (Protozoa, P. aeruginosa,P. fluorescens) and the mixed isolates (P. aeruginosa+ P. fluorescens). The bestincubation period for the three isolates is 72 hours. the optimum operationconditions for mixed isolated are biomass 5.22 g/L, BOD5 15 mg/L, TSS 95 mg/L,TDS 4500 mg/L and S.T 25 m.N/m. These results have show that mixed isolates arethe best for consumption of hydrocarbon residuals
